What simply occurred? Trade watchers have been intently monitoring indicators of rising costs in shopper expertise. Because of analysis by YouTuber Cameron Dougherty, we now have clear proof of worth will increase in well-liked PC equipment. Dougherty has completed the legwork by analyzing a broad vary of Logitech merchandise, reporting worth hikes of as much as 25 p.c on a number of the firm’s most sought-after keyboards and mice, amongst different gadgets.
In his video, Dougherty raises questions concerning the impression of ongoing tariffs and the longer term affordability of tech gear in america. Flagship merchandise such because the Logitech MX Master 3S mouse and the K400 Plus Wireless Touch Keyboard had been amongst these affected. The latter elevated in worth from $27.99 to $34.99 – a modest $7 leap that nonetheless represents a major 25 p.c rise.
Dougherty’s findings additionally observe that whereas some merchandise have develop into costlier, others have remained steady and even dropped in worth. As an illustration, the G Pro X Superlight mouse dropped from $159.99 to $149.99.
To confirm these claims, Tom’s Hardware carried out its personal investigation and corroborated a number of of Dougherty’s observations. For instance, the MX Keys S keyboard is now listed at $130 on Logitech’s official web site, reflecting an 18 p.c enhance. The MX Grasp 3S mouse has climbed 20 p.c, from $100 to $120. The K400 Plus Wi-fi Contact keyboard’s worth hike, although smaller in absolute phrases, stands out for its proportion leap.
Notably, these will increase haven’t been accompanied by any public announcement from Logitech. Some gadgets have appeared on sale at main retailers like Amazon, however the discounted costs are nonetheless increased than historic norms, suggesting a brand new baseline has been established.
The explanations behind these modifications are advanced however seem like intently tied to the turbulent tariff atmosphere. The Trump administration’s tariffs on imported items, particularly these from China, have despatched ripples via the tech trade.
Many producers, together with Logitech, rely closely on Chinese language manufacturing, leaving them significantly susceptible to those coverage shifts. Earlier this month, Logitech withdrew its monetary forecast for the upcoming fiscal yr, explicitly citing ongoing uncertainty round tariffs as a driving issue.
Whereas some tariffs have been quickly paused, these on Chinese language imports stay steep, forcing corporations to navigate a panorama of unpredictable prices and provide chain disruptions.
Logitech shouldn’t be alone in adjusting its pricing. Different manufacturers, similar to accent maker Anker which is predicated in China, have additionally raised costs on merchandise like chargers, with reported will increase of round 18 p.c.
Trade consultants warning that these changes will not be the final, as producers proceed to adapt to evolving commerce insurance policies and the potential for additional escalation within the U.S.-China commerce dispute.
